Helen Sullivan

Graveside services for Helen Vassar Sullivan was held on Wednesday, March 1, 2023, at 1 p.m. at South Bend Cemetery in Graham. There was no visitation.

Memorial services will be held on Saturday, March 11, 2023, at 1 p.m. at First Baptist Church in Teague. A celebration will be held at Teague City Park at 4 p.m. to carry out Helen’s request to feed the kids in the community.

Kids in the Teague community called Helen, “Ahji.” Days before she passed away, she shared her wish to feed the kids in the park one more time.

Helen “Ahji” Vassar Sullivan of Teague went to her heavenly home on Feb. 26, 2023, at the age of 77. She was born in Bowie on Nov. 21, 1945.

Helen was a faithful woman who loved the Lord, her family, church, India, and her community. She was known to always have an interesting story to tell and enjoyed sharing them with all.

Ahji spent her life in India, Virginia, and Texas where she lead many to the Lord. On her birthday in 1965, she met her husband, Robert, in Abilene.

On April 21, 1967, the two were married in Montana and moved to Texas.

Helen was preceded in death by her parents; Rev. Ted and Rev. Estelle Vassar, brothers; Bobby Jo and Ted Vassar; and daughter; Gina Sullivan Neusch.

She is survived by her husband of nearly 56 years, Robert E. Sullivan of Teague; one son, Eddie Sullivan and wife, Kim S ullivan of Socorro, New Mexico; one daughter, Missy Newhouse and husband, Butch of Mexia,; one son-in-law, Michael Neusch of Canton; one sister, Dr. Ruth Burgess and husband of Stafford, Missouri; five grandchildren, John Sullivan, Emily Sullivan, Erin Neusch Bendiksen, Ian Sullivan, and Madison Newhouse; two great-grandchildren, Everleigh and Eleanor Bendiksen; many cousins, nieces, and nephews. She also is survived by her dachshund, Sissy, that snuggled with her to the end.

Helen had a passion for life and continuously cared for everyone around her. We will all miss her laughter and smiles, singing, generosity and great deeds she continuously did.
